Question 1: How do you prepare the X-ray inspection system before use?

Candidate 1: Checks equipment readiness, powers on the system, and ensures basic calibration is complete.
Candidate 2: Performs full system calibration, verifies imaging accuracy, checks shielding integrity, and confirms safety interlocks before operation.

Panel Debate: The NDT Specialist values Candidate 2’s technical rigor, while Candidate 1 is recognized for reliable operational readiness.
Scores: Candidate 1 – 8 | Candidate 2 – 9

Question 2: How do you identify internal defects using X-ray images?

Candidate 1: Reviews images carefully and identifies visible cracks or irregularities.
Candidate 2: Analyzes image density variations, structural inconsistencies, and subtle defect patterns for deeper inspection accuracy.

Panel Debate: The Quality Assurance Engineer favors Candidate 2’s analytical interpretation, while Candidate 1 is noted for basic defect recognition.
Scores: Candidate 1 – 8 | Candidate 2 – 9

Question 3: How do you ensure radiation safety during inspections?

Candidate 1: Follows safety protocols, wears protective gear, and follows operational guidelines strictly.
Candidate 2: Actively monitors radiation exposure levels, enforces safety zones, and ensures compliance with real-time safety standards.

Panel Debate: The Safety Compliance Officer strongly supports Candidate 2’s proactive safety control, while Candidate 1 is valued for compliance discipline.
Scores: Candidate 1 – 8 | Candidate 2 – 9

Question 4: How do you document inspection findings?

Candidate 1: Records defects and prepares standard inspection reports.
Candidate 2: Produces detailed reports with image annotations, defect classification, and actionable recommendations.

Panel Debate: The QA Engineer highlights Candidate 2’s detailed reporting, while Candidate 1 is recognized for structured documentation.
Scores: Candidate 1 – 8 | Candidate 2 – 9

Question 6: How do you handle equipment issues during inspection?

Candidate 1: Stops operation and reports technical issues to maintenance teams.
Candidate 2: Identifies early system irregularities, performs basic troubleshooting checks, and escalates with detailed fault analysis.

Panel Debate: The Safety Officer values Candidate 2’s diagnostic awareness, while Candidate 1 is recognized for safe escalation practices.
Scores: Candidate 1 – 8 | Candidate 2 – 9
